Output 8fe8d623b23eba95b9133ab25f5c87cd89300c8b580da4a4c35257236635b096:1

value
49899774000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cafcdf70587390935a72adb9c93085baaa9fcc3e OP_EQUALVERIFY OP_CHECKSIG
address
DPePxvFTCTzMVYgPXuEwVG2koXgdwKf8U8
transaction
8fe8d623b23eba95b9133ab25f5c87cd89300c8b580da4a4c35257236635b096